Kate, thank you so much for taking the time to share your lessons learned with us and we’re sure your wisdom will help many. So, one question that comes up often and that we’re hoping you can shed some light on is keeping creativity alive over long stretches – how do you keep your creativity alive?
Collecting paper scraps for my travel scrapbook and using my watercolor set on the go keeps my creativity alive when I am not working on larger painting projects. A traditional record of interest and experience nurtures my daily and long-term creativity. Reflection feels most natural when transcribed through colorful forms, allowing for fluidity of processing where all is true at once in hidden language.

Great, so let’s take a few minutes and cover your story. What should folks know about you and what you do?
I exhibit my paintings in art exhibitions and sell art prints of my work. I recently had a solo show called “Planet Bunny” with a pop up print shop. For 2026, I would like to do many more in person events. I have had three solo shows all with very similar themes of play and color as psychological processing which absolves into otherworldly spaces, commonly inhabited by pink bunnies who are curious and brave.

Looking back, what do you think were the three qualities, skills, or areas of knowledge that were most impactful in your journey? What advice do you have for folks who are early in their journey in terms of how they can best develop or improve on these?
As I was building self esteem in my early 20s, apart from religion, painting gave me an outlet to practice being playful, open, and curious to new possibilities. It helped connect me to myself and showcase evidence of personal choice and decision making. My advice is to explore your passion to the fullest extent on a personal level.
